Released in 2007, Cool is a comedy film directed by Nikos Perakis, running about 100 minutes. “There is no game...” — that tagline sets the tone.

What it’s about. The film follows the parallel and entwining stories as well as the common fates of some very different young people for 24 hours in the summertime: from the prison to the corridors of the airport and from the Saronikos beaches to the Psiloritis mountain. The common characteristic of the heroes is that they have inherited from their nefarious parents various problems. In spite of the fact that they used to be neutral, due to specials conditions they will be forced to grow up.

Who’s in it. Cool stars Giannis Tsimitselis as Tzortzis Mandrakas, Andreas Konstantinou as Minos Stavrakomanios, Eftyhia Yakoumi as Hloi Lyhnaftia and George Hraniotis as Bilis Androulakos, among others.
